Samatime is a restaurant housed in a traditional wooden building that serves dishes in special seto dishes native to the region. I ordered the Buddha bowl from their lunch menu, which included a variety of delicious items for 1500 yen. The meal also came with a miso soup, which was very satisfying. Even my sister and her husband, who usually eat animal products, enjoyed their meal. I was pleased to see flyers from the Animal Rights Center Japan on display and on the tables with the menu. The restaurant converted to a fully vegan menu in June 2019. (Updated review as of July 27, 2020)
